Hotel Description
Located in Christchurch a 3-minute walk from Canterbury Museum The Observatory Hotel Christchurch has accommodations with a fitness center and private parking. This 5-star hotel offers a 24-hour front desk a concierge service and free WiFi. The property is half a mile from the city center and a 7-minute walk from Christchurch Art Gallery. The hotel will provide guests with air-conditioned rooms with a closet a coffee machine a minibar a safety deposit box a flat-screen TV and a private bathroom with a shower. At The Observatory Hotel Christchurch rooms are equipped with bed linen and towels. The area is popular for cycling and bike rental and car rental are available at the accommodation. Popular points of interest near The Observatory Hotel Christchurch include Hagley Park Bridge of Remembrance and The Chalice. The nearest airport is Christchurch International Airport 6.2 miles from the hotel.

Check-in time: 14:00   Check-out time: 10:00
